Step-by-Step Overview to Working with a Denver Immigration Lawyer
Every immigration case is one-of-a-kind, but the process of working with a Denver immigration lawyer generally follows a clear, organized path. Having a roadmap aids you understand what will certainly take place next, what you need to do, and just how to prevent unforced blunders that cause anxiety and delay.
Initial Examination and Instance Screening-- The initial step is a detailed examination where you describe your history: when and exactly how you went into the United States, prior applications, criminal or website traffic concerns, member of the family with status, and any letters from immigration. Your lawyer will certainly identify all possible alternatives, such as household requests, modification of standing, consular processing, asylum, U visas, VAWA, termination of elimination, or naturalization. Document Collection and Timeline Planning-- Following, you gather crucial documents. This might consist of keys, birth and marriage certificates, I-94 documents, old applications, court dispositions, tax returns, and pay stubs. Your attorney produces a timeline that makes up Denver-specific truths: local biometrics visits, USCIS processing times, and Denver immigration court setups if you are in elimination process. Strategy Choice and Threat Review-- Together, you select the most safe and most reliable route. As an example, a spouse of an U.S. citizen living in Capitol Hill might qualify to change status in the USA, while a person living in Montbello with an old elimination order may need an activity to reopen or unique waivers. Your lawyer will clarify possible results, including worst-case circumstances, prior to anything is submitted. Preparing and Filing the Application-- Your lawyer completes the proper immigration kinds, writes lawful disagreements when needed, and arranges proof in such a way that is clear to immigration police officers and judges. In Denver, this can likewise include working with translations, notarizations, and specialist letters (such as mental analyses for hardship waivers). Responding to Requests and Notices-- After declaring, you might obtain an Ask for Evidence (RFE), a notification for biometrics, a job authorization authorization, or a hearing day at the Denver immigration court. Your lawyer tracks these records, calendars deadlines, and prepares you for every step, including what to bring and exactly how to answer typical concerns. Interview or Court Hearing Preparation-- For permit meetings at the local USCIS office or hearings at the Denver immigration court, preparation is important. Your attorney will examine your background, technique most likely concerns, check for disparities, and aid you understand court room or meeting etiquette so you feel more certain and less distressed. Decision, Appeals, and Following Steps-- When a decision gets here, your lawyer assesses it with you in detail. If it is an approval, you will get support on maintaining your status and planning for future actions such as revival or citizenship. If it is a rejection or elimination order, your lawyer can analyze appeal options, activities to reopen, or different forms of relief.This step-by-step method turns a confusing procedure right into a collection of clear tasks. As opposed to guessing and wishing, you move on with structure and assistance, which is particularly crucial in an active immigration environment like Denver.
Common Immigration Troubles Denver Citizens Face
Denver immigrants and mixed-status households face a certain mix of obstacles linked to local enforcement patterns, real estate stress, and lengthy work hours. Many individuals postpone obtaining lawful aid because they are afraid, self-conscious, or presume they do not receive any type of alleviation. Regrettably, waiting commonly makes issues worse.
One regular concern we see is ended or almost ran out short-lived status. Students that concerned participate in schools near downtown Denver or employees employed around the Denver Technology Facility might overstay visas without realizing how major that can be. Overstays can limit future options and might require cautious timing or waivers to deal with. A Denver immigration lawyer can evaluate your complete history before you leave the country or file anything brand-new.
An additional usual issue includes incomplete or inaccurate applications submitted without lawful guidance. On the internet resources make types look simple, however immigration law is more than documents. We frequently fulfill clients from communities like Five Points, Baker, or Highland that filed on their own, just to get RFEs, denials, or even court notices because they misunderstood eligibility rules, public charge inquiries, or rap sheet disclosures.
Households in rental-heavy locations, such as parts of Aurora-border communities and West Denver, typically battle with address changes. If you move and stop working to upgrade your address appropriately, essential notices from USCIS or the Denver immigration court can be sent to the incorrect place. Missing out on a hearing can cause an in absentia removal order, which is very major and can be hard-- but not constantly impossible-- to reopen.
We also see confusion around mixed-status families. For example, U.S.-citizen kids might live with undocumented parents functioning near downtown hotels or building and construction websites along I-25. Moms and dads might assume they have no options, yet some might get cancellation of elimination, waivers based upon challenge to certifying relatives, or future family-based requests. Recognizing these opportunities early lets families make far better choices about work, traveling, Law Offices of Miguel Martinez and long-term planning in Denver.
Key Factors to consider and Expenses When Hiring a Denver Immigration Lawyer
When you are considering hiring a Denver immigration lawyer, price is necessary-- but it needs to not be the only variable. Immigration choices influence your job, your household, and often your capability to return to the United States if you leave. It deserves taking some time to understand what enters into pricing and what questions to ask before you dedicate.
A lot of immigration law firms in Denver utilize level fees for specific situation types, such as marriage-based green cards, DACA renewals, or naturalization. The cost commonly relies on just how complex your history is. As an example, an uncomplicated permit situation for a spouse with a clean record who entered with a visa will generally cost much less than an instance involving previous deportations, illegal access, or criminal costs. Much more complicated instances need much deeper study, mindful lawful arguments, and more time in interaction with firms and the court.
Along with attorney costs, you have to think about government filing charges, translation expenses, medical exam fees, and possible specialist reports. USCIS fees alone can be numerous hundred and even over a thousand dollars for some applications. A good immigration lawyer will certainly provide you a break down of anticipated prices prior to filing, so you recognize both lawful fees and government charges and can prepare economically.
Trust and interaction are also key considerations. You ought to really feel comfy asking inquiries in your main language or with the assistance of interpretation. Look for a Denver immigration lawyer that explains things plainly, gives realistic expectations, and is sincere concerning threats. Watch out for any individual that promises specific outcomes or warranties success; immigration outcomes always rely on the facts, the law, and the decision-maker.

What needs to I bring to my very first meeting with a Denver immigration lawyer?
Bring any passports, work permits, old visas, I-94 records, prior applications, receipt notices, court documents, and criminal or traffic files. Also bring marital relationship certifications, birth certificates for youngsters, and any letters from immigration firms. The even more complete your documents are, the more accurately your lawyer can examine your alternatives.
Is whatever I inform my Denver immigration lawyer confidential?
Yes. Communications with a licensed immigration lawyer are private and secured by attorney-- customer privilege, with unusual exemptions defined by law. This security permits you to be straightforward concerning entries, exits, prior marital relationships, criminal issues, and other sensitive details so your attorney can construct the best and most sincere case feasible.
